Market Size and Overview

The Global Infrared Thermometer Market size is estimated to be valued at USD 16.05 billion in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 25.94 billion by 2032,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.1% from 2025 to 2032.

Infrared Thermometer Market Forecast demonstrates strong market revenue growth driven by increasing adoption in healthcare diagnostics, industrial applications, and rising awareness about hygienic non-contact devices. Market analysis suggests steady market growth supported by emerging markets and technological breakthroughs enhancing product accuracy and user convenience.

Key Takeaways

- Dominating Region: North America maintains its dominance in the Infrared Thermometer Market size due to its advanced healthcare infrastructure and regulatory support for non-contact medical devices, evidenced by the FDA’s updated guidelines in 2024.
- Fastest Growing Region: Asia Pacific is the fastest-growing region, boosted by expanding healthcare facilities and industrial automation in countries like India and China.
- By Product Type:
- Dominant Sub-segment: Handheld infrared thermometers continue to lead due to portability and ease of use. For instance, Fluke Corporation’s latest handheld offerings in 2025 saw a 20% sales increase in North America.
- Fastest Growing Sub-segment: Wall-mounted thermometers are rapidly gaining traction in institutional settings, with more deployments reported in Asia-Pacific hospitals.
- By End-User Industry:
- Dominant Sub-segment: Healthcare remains the largest user, driven by continuous demand for rapid fever screening post-pandemic.
- Fastest Growing Sub-segment: Industrial applications, such as in manufacturing line monitoring, showed accelerated uptake from 2024 onwards in Europe.
- By Technology:
- Dominant Sub-segment: Infrared sensor-based thermometers leading the market due to accuracy.
- Fastest Growing Sub-segment: Integration of IoT-enabled infrared thermometers is gaining momentum, reflecting 15% growth in smart healthcare implementations during 2025.

Market Key Trends

One of the most important market trends shaping the Infrared Thermometer Market in 2025 is the integration of IoT (Internet of Things) technology for enhanced data analytics and remote monitoring. Recent product launches in 2024 and 2025 by various market companies introduced smart infrared thermometers capable of real-time data transmission to health monitoring systems and industrial control units. For example, OMRON Corporation unveiled an IoT-enabled thermometer in early 2025 that allows hospitals to monitor patient temperatures continuously without manual intervention. This innovation not only augments operational efficiency but also supports predictive health diagnostics.
